Welcome to Spark and Scribble, a home for narrated short stories born of worldbuilding chaos and dangerously nerdy inspiration. I’m a professional daydreamer powered by too much coffee, funny-shaped dice, wild “what ifs,” and a sci-fi/fantasy (and more) packed bookshelf. Whether you’re a DM, a lore gremlin, or someone who just loves escaping for a few minutes, this corner is ours to share. I’ve challenged myself to write, narrate, and produce as many audio stories as I can and share the journey along the way. If these stories help you escape, even for a moment, then they’ve done their job.

Cadia: The Breaking of the 88th

The Fall of Cadia is not remembered through legends.

It is remembered through moments... small, precise, and irreversible.

This is a narrated Warhammer 40,000 story following a single Cadian squad in the final hours of the world’s destruction. Not a retelling of the siege, but a ground-level account of ordinary Guardsmen making correct decisions in an incorrect universe.
